Inspection on 3/13/2025

High Priority
1
Intermediate
0
Basic
1
Total
2
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ards

Inspection Details:

  • 08B-17-4:Basic - Unwashed fruits/vegetables stored with ready-to-eat food. Observed an employee cutting strawberries without washing. Employee washed the cut and uncut strawberries. **Corrected On-Site**
  • 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Raw tuna stored over washed and cut cabbage in the reach in cooler on the cook line. Employee placed the tuna below the cabbage. **Corrected On-Site**

Inspection on 2/27/2025

High Priority
3
Intermediate
0
Basic
0
Total
3
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ards

Inspection Details:

  • 12A-20-4:High Priority - Employee washed hands with no soap. The employee was informed and properly washed their hands. **Corrective Action Taken**
  • 08A-20-5:High Priority - Raw animal foods not properly separated from each other in holding unit based upon minimum required cooking temperature. Raw ground beef stored over raw mahi in the stand up reach in cooler in the back kitchen area. Chef placed the ground beef below the mahi. **Corrected On-Site**
  • 03F-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food identified in the written procedure as a food held using time as a public health control has no time marking and the time removed from temperature control cannot be determined. See stop sale. Hollandaise sauce on time as a public health control stored at room temperature on the cook line with no time mark. Chef stated the sauce had been on time for approximately 1 hour. Chef place a time mark on the sauce. **Corrected On-Site**

Inspection on 10/25/2024

High Priority
0
Intermediate
1
Basic
3
Total
4
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ards

Inspection Details:

  • 36-34-5:Basic - Ceiling/ceiling tiles/vents soiled with accumulated food debris, grease, dust, or mold-like substance. Ceiling vents above the expo line soiled.
  • 22-16-4:Basic - Reach-in cooler interior has accumulation of soil residues. Interior of the reach in cooler on the right side of the bar soiled.
  • 36-27-5:Basic - Wall soiled with accumulated grease, food debris, and/or dust. Walls in the dishwasher area behind the sprayer hose soiled. **Repeat Violation**
  • 31B-03-4:Intermediate - No soap provided at handwash sink. No soap at the hand washing sink in the cook line area. Chef placed soap at the hand washing sink. **Corrected On-Site**
